I am an American Citizen who just graduated from a good university with a degree in Economics. I want to be able to move to Canada and be able to legally work there. I am having a hard time finding a job without having a visa. Can someone tell me what the quickest way to get a visa is to work.

K., what you want is going to be very difficult. You want a work permit (not a visa), and you have to find an employer willing to get HRSDC approval for a Labor Market Opinion (LMO) before you can get a work permit. It's not impossible, but... eluta.ca and jobbank.gc.ca are places to start looking. Consider graduate school in Canada if you really want to come to Canada.
 
Or you could look into the Youth Exchange program if you meet the criteria. It's not permanent immigration but would give you chance to live and work in Canada for a time to see if you really like it.
